Heat causes vasodilation of the blood vessels. If you had not fully healed from any damaged blood vessels injured during the injection, you would risk increased bleeding in the area initially. This is why ice is used instead to limit bruising, as it has the opposite effect. After 6 hours you would be safe for the heating pad but limit the duration to no more than 15 minute intervals.
